About the role

We are working with an entrepreneurial company that provides pathway courses, English language provision and direct subject delivery in China. It partners with Universities from Australia, New Zealand and UK, and is experiencing rapid growth. We are looking for capable academic leaders who will play a central role in driving the development of the business, working effectively to ensure that systems and processes function, and that quality standards are in place. Each "Dean" will oversee, and be based in, a region of China, building close working relationships with local and international partners. The roles will suit innovative and resourceful academics who would relish the opportunity to work in a vibrant and fast-moving environment. They would suit people currently in leadership roles such as Head of Department, Associate Dean or Head of School, and with experience of UK, Australian or NZ or equivalent quality systems, regulation and compliance. A strong understanding of China would be ideal. The roles will pay a competitive package for individuals at the right level and a pathway to academic progression.
